The University of Connecticut is proud to announce the 2019 Dr. Martin Luther King Jr. Living Legacy Convocation. The keynote speaker is the Honorable Richard A. Robinson, the first African-American Chief Justice of the Connecticut Supreme Court. The theme is Courageous Paths. In addition to the keynote, we’ll have a Q&A as well as a musical and spoken word tributes. The Convocation is open to the public and free of charge and does not require registration.
The program begins at 3:30pm on Thursday, January 24th, 2019, on the Storrs Campus in the Jorgensen Auditorium.
